Representative Text

1 Lord, help us to en­sure
A lot among the blest,
And watch a mo­ment to se­cure
An ev­er­last­ing rest.

2 To damp our earth­ly joys,
T’increase our gra­cious fears,
Forever let th’arch­an­gel’s voice
Be sound­ing in our ears.

3 The sol­emn mid­night cry,
"Ye dead, the Judge is come!
Arise, and meet Him in the sky,
And meet your in­stant doom!"

4 O may we thus be found
Obedient to Thy word,
Attentive to the trump­et’s sound,
And look­ing for our Lord.
